Course structure

• Introduction to Household Pesticides and Their Risks
• Understanding Pesticide Labels and Safety Data Sheets (SDS)
• Health and Environmental Impacts of Household Pesticides
• Safe Storage, Handling, and Disposal of Pesticides
• Integrated Pest Management (IPM) Strategies for Households
• First Aid and Emergency Response for Pesticide Exposure
• Regulatory Frameworks and Compliance for Pesticide Use
• Risk Communication and Public Awareness Campaigns
• Alternatives to Chemical Pesticides in Household Settings
• Case Studies and Best Practices in Household Pesticide Risk Reduction

Career path

Pesticide Safety Officer

Ensures compliance with safety regulations and conducts risk assessments for household pesticide use.

Environmental Health Specialist

Monitors and mitigates the environmental impact of household pesticides in urban and rural areas.

Pest Control Technician

Applies household pesticides safely and effectively to manage pest infestations in residential settings.

Regulatory Compliance Advisor

Guides businesses and households on adhering to pesticide regulations and safety standards.
